📖 Summary
John Sununu is a distinguished political figure who served as the White House Chief of Staff under President George H.W. Bush from 1989 to 1991. Throughout his tenure, Sununu was known for his steadfast leadership and unwavering commitment to advancing the administration's agenda. With his extensive experience in government and politics, he played a pivotal role in shaping the policies and decisions that defined the Bush presidency.
Before assuming the role of White House Chief of Staff, Sununu had an impressive career in public service. He served as the Governor of New Hampshire from 1983 to 1989, where he made significant strides in improving the state's economy and infrastructure. His achievements as governor earned him a reputation as a pragmatic and effective leader, paving the way for his subsequent role in national politics.

Frequently Asked Questions about John Sununu
Is John Sununu related to Chris Sununu?
Personal life. Sununu is married to Nancy Hayes, and they have eight children, including former U.S. Senator John E. Sununu and Chris Sununu, formerly a member of the New Hampshire Executive Council and currently the Governor of New Hampshire.
What is the religion of governor Sununu?
His paternal grandfather, also named John, was born in the United States, and most of the last two generations of Sununus were also born in the U.S. When he took office as governor, Sununu was sworn in with a Greek Orthodox New Testament Bible belonging to his family.
Was Sununu a senator?
John Edward Sununu (born September 10, 1964) is an American politician who served as a member of the U.S. House of Representatives from 1997 to 2003 and the U.S. Senate representing New Hampshire from 2003 to 2009.
